COURSE STRUCTURE



Schedule - Fall 2015
The course is divided into 3 modules, with four topics covered in each module. The course is structured in such a way that each topic is covered over the course of a week.
Following the Monday and Wednesday lectures, students are expected to:
1. Read the assigned required weekly readings;
2. View the assigned video clips not shown in class;
3. Consider the key concepts for the topic;
4. Formulate responses to the thematic review questions for the topic.
These four components represent the preparation for the discussion sections which follow the Monday/Wednesday lectures.
